Visitors taking a closer look at an artefact featured in the Tales Of The Malay World: Manuscripts And Early Books exhibition at the National Library in Singapore. Photo: The Straits Times/ANN

Even in dim light, the gold leaf and jewel hues of the Taj Al-Salatin gleam.

This 19th-century copy of the 17th-century text, the title of which translates to The Crown Of Kings, has spent years in the collection of the British Library. Now, it has finally returned to the part of the world where it came into being.
